#[doc = r"Register block"]
#[repr(C)]
pub struct RegisterBlock {
#[doc = "0x00 - Control register 0"]
pub ctrlr0: CTRLR0,
#[doc = "0x04 - Master Control register 1"]
pub ctrlr1: CTRLR1,
#[doc = "0x08 - SSI Enable"]
pub ssienr: SSIENR,
#[doc = "0x0c - Microwire Control"]
pub mwcr: MWCR,
#[doc = "0x10 - Slave enable"]
pub ser: SER,
#[doc = "0x14 - Baud rate"]
pub baudr: BAUDR,
#[doc = "0x18 - TX FIFO threshold level"]
pub txftlr: TXFTLR,
#[doc = "0x1c - RX FIFO threshold level"]
pub rxftlr: RXFTLR,
#[doc = "0x20 - TX FIFO level"]
pub txflr: TXFLR,
#[doc = "0x24 - RX FIFO level"]
pub rxflr: RXFLR,
#[doc = "0x28 - Status register"]
pub sr: SR,
#[doc = "0x2c - Interrupt mask"]
pub imr: IMR,
#[doc = "0x30 - Interrupt status"]
pub isr: ISR,
#[doc = "0x34 - Raw interrupt status"]
pub risr: RISR,
#[doc = "0x38 - TX FIFO overflow interrupt clear"]
pub txoicr: TXOICR,
#[doc = "0x3c - RX FIFO overflow interrupt clear"]
pub rxoicr: RXOICR,
#[doc = "0x40 - RX FIFO underflow interrupt clear"]
pub rxuicr: RXUICR,
#[doc = "0x44 - Multi-master interrupt clear"]
pub msticr: MSTICR,
#[doc = "0x48 - Interrupt clear"]
pub icr: ICR,
#[doc = "0x4c - DMA control"]
pub dmacr: DMACR,
#[doc = "0x50 - DMA TX data level"]
pub dmatdlr: DMATDLR,
#[doc = "0x54 - DMA RX data level"]
pub dmardlr: DMARDLR,
#[doc = "0x58 - Identification register"]
pub idr: IDR,
#[doc = "0x5c - Version ID"]
pub ssi_version_id: SSI_VERSION_ID,
#[doc = "0x60 - Data Register 0 (of 36)"]
pub dr0: DR0,
_reserved25: [u8; 140usize],
#[doc = "0xf0 - RX sample delay"]
pub rx_sample_dly: RX_SAMPLE_DLY,
#[doc = "0xf4 - SPI control"]
pub spi_ctrlr0: SPI_CTRLR0,
#[doc = "0xf8 - TX drive edge"]
pub txd_drive_edge: TXD_DRIVE_EDGE,
}
